component contains a
— the HTML element that defines a form. The structure we’ve got here is intended to be simple. Copy. When the data is handled by the components, all the data is stored in the component state. We need to import useform, useFieldArray & Controller from the react-hook-form-library. Hope this answer helped to figure out what's going on When the process is complete, cd into the moz-todo-react directory and run the command npm start. Create two state variables countries and colours to store the details of few countries and colours as an array and an object respectively. Today, we will learn how to create a dynamic React table and add and delete rows using SharePoint Framework (SPFx). My team uses React/React Native to build production apps over 3 years. This will create a sample React application with the development environment fully configured. Throughout this tutorial, we'll be using PHP with React and Axios to create a simple REST API application with CRUD operations. Which of them will have state? Finally, add our container as a route in src/Routes.js below our login route. Copy. We recommend to check out the examples. I like to go through a little React checklist: 1. 1) Create Model for the project. How to create a Dynamic Bootstrap Dropdown Component in React JS? Ideally, the checkbox is a functional graphical user interface element. To make the table header dynamic the data should be from the backend or should be a dynamic way to fetch. It is made Creating a Form — Controlled Component vs. Uncontrolled Component. In here, I am going to share form toggle editable built with React.js and Formik. How adding/removing input elements dynamically possible? Yes, it is possible, you can add/remove input elements dynamically , But for that you n... In this case, I feel like it would read nicely to have a main Form component, and then CatInputs components that we ca… Search functionality is useful for many types of websites, … Form rendering and submission are quite simple in React … The starting point for this tutorial can be accessed here, and the complete code found here. Add the Route. If you want to add form validation on submitting with a form component in react js app. Recently I have implemented this. Custom validators in AngularJS - Includes more ideas on the topic of how AngularJS handles form validation; Beginner React Video Course - Learn about ReactJS at your own pace One of the challenges was to create a new team registration form. In order to link the state of a form component to a form input, we can use the onChange handler. Well, in this article I will walk you through the step by step process of creating React forms and use ‘new blog’ as an example. In order to achieve this first, I declare 2 states and 1 ref. Breadcrumbs dynamic navigation is implemented using various JavaScript functions like jQuery prepend () ,clone () and click () methods. The dynamic search box is a search bar with a text field to take the user input and then perform some operation on the user input to show him the dynamic results based on his input.API calls in made whenever a user starts typing in order to show him the dynamic options. Building dynamic forms with Formik with React and TypeScript Sep 01, 2018. The first thing we need to do is properly configure our directory structure so Next.js recognizes the dynamic path. Creating a list in the browser is a super common technique for displaying a list of data. The form contains admin, agent input field, and team name. In the last lesson, you learn how to set style dynamically and then you learn simple use javascript to manipulate whatever you then bind to that style property. In this tutorial we learned a few things about how to create a Form element in React, and how we can take action on the data we capture. This guide will demonstrate how to build a performant, accessible form with Next.js while teaching the best practices for HTML & React forms along the way. This library use regular css created from scratch, so user can customize it in the future. In a dynamic component, we just pass the options object and the component will create dynamic options into the dropdown. Follow the steps below to create a new React app, And include our component in the header. Here we will provide you very simple and very easy example, that helps you to understand creation process of simple popup in react JS. In this react hook form validation example i will simply create a react functional component form and will validate it using react hook form package and then submit it with the form data. bash. It is used as “key” prop the component and also this value is used for dynamically create … In order to set up a dynamic route, we need to create our folder exactly like: - pages -- character --- [id] -- index.js If you wondered, how you can create a dynamic input form and implement that feature using React JS. A const variable is created with a name columnHeader. I’ll keep the starter template of CRA so that we focus directly on the point of our interest. ## For react-hook-formm npm install --save react-hook-form && ## (optional) material-ui npm install --save @material-ui/core @material-ui/icons. and below is the react component for the form which I need to create dynamically, as of now i have 3 fields which are static and need to dynamically put from the above json. It gives the basis of a simple form with some inputs directly in the component. Basically, I am struggling to find how to set each individual dynamic input field to a corresponding element on an array. Whenever you obtain information from React and if it's dynamic, keep track of it through the use of state. A Simple React.js Form Example Summary. Form Validations in React.js. JSON based dynamic forms with ReactJS. In HTML, form elements such as ,